Specifying a Destination

Searching for an E-mail address through the LDAP server

When using an LDAP server or Active Directory in Windows Server, search for an E-mail address through the
server.
There are two ways to search: Use [Address Search (LDAP)] in which a fax number is searched by a single
keyword, and use [Adv. Search (LDAP)] in which a fax number is searched by a combination of keywords of
different categories.
0
To use an LDAP server or Active Directory to specify the destination, you must register the server on
this machine. The registration process is explained using Web Connection. For details, refer to "User's
Guide [Web Management Tool]/[Configuring the Scan Environment]".
1
Tap [Addr. Search] - [Search] - [Address Search (LDAP)] or [Adv. Search (LDAP)].
2
Enter the keyword, then tap [Search].
% Using [Address Search (LDAP)]
% To use [Adv. Search (LDAP)]
3
Select the destination from the search result.
